SpringBoot快速集成Activiti7的实践教程
作为IT技术学习者,一个好的项目Demo工程,结合相关知识学习,是最佳的学习方式。
下面我们来看下SpringBoot快速集成Activiti7的实践教程,学好Activiti7,一个好的Demo工程就够了。
首先,我们看下Activiti简介。
什么是工作流?
工作流指通过计算机对业务流程进行自动化管理,实现多个参与者按照预定义的流程去自动执行业务流程。
什么是Activiti?
Activiti 是一个开源架构的工作流引擎,基于bpmn2.0 标准进行流程定义。其前身是JBPM,Activiti 通过嵌入到业务系统开发中进行使用。
接着我们看下Demo工程的实现功能,更直观地理解Activiti的使用。
登录页面
系统首页
创建流程定义
流程定义列表
任务审核页面
springboot-activiti
介绍
springboot-activiti是一个SpringBoot集成activiti实现在创建、部署流程、复制流程、删除流程以及流程规则配置,实现工单流程工作流流转和业务处理,有需要同学可以发送主题“springboot-activiti”至1829003685@qq.com获取项目源码与视频。
本项目主要实现activit流程相关的业务
增加通过页面动态控制定时任务的启动、暂停、创建、删除
获取项目工程
数据库脚本文件
工作流生命周期
Activiti架构
IDEA插件–actiBPM
事件及监听器原理